2006-07 Season: Had a 3-5 record in dual singles... overpowered North Texas' Sara Pesic 6-2, 6-0... topped Quincy Carter of Montana 6-1, 6-2... defeated UC Santa Barbara's Bryanna Ojeda.

Coach Somers' Take
Tennis: A talented freshman who came out of the USTA NorCal section, ranked #15. In 2003 she was the team #1 player and MVP at Woodside Priory High School, where she went 17-0 in league play.
